Question
what was the primary goal of the classification system created by carolus linnaeus?
to determine the age of different organisms found on earth.
to explain how organisms could acquire new traits during their lifetime.
to prove that all species have remained unchanged since their creation.
to organize and describe the diversity of life based on shared features.
Carolus Linnaeus's classification system (taxonomy) aimed to organize and describe the diversity of life by grouping organisms with shared features. The first option is about dating organisms (not his goal), the second about acquired traits (related to Lamarck, not Linnaeus), the third about unchanging species (not his focus; he focused on organization).
